Pastor Joel Webbon, a leading voice in biblical historic Christianity, and Brayden Sorbo, a prominent Rift TV contributor, dive deep into pressing societal issues. They reflect on America's moral decline and the growing need for faith. The duo tackles the tension between traditional teachings and modern liberalism in Christianity, while also critiquing societal dynamics regarding crime and accountability. They engage in a spirited discussion about gender roles, the impact of vigilantism, and the intersection of morality with contemporary issues, providing listeners with thought-provoking insights.
